I have FOLFOX induced neuropathy. Chemo ended in November of 2008. 8 months later, the sensation problems became compounded with carpal tunnel-like symptoms which have not resolved after 6 months. It would be helpful if someone could lead me to the posts/threads which will be most valuable to me. I want to know what treatments/therapies have been found to be helpful. Chemo is a special problem.

The only nutrient I have found in studies to help is Acetyl Carnitine.

http://neurotalk.psychcentral.com/sh...ighlight=chemo

Also you will want to look at thyroid functions. Low thyroid can cause both foot PN and carpal tunnel.
